A new species of Elachistocleis Parker (Anura, Microhylidae) from the State of Acre, Northern Brazil

A new species of Elachistocleis is described from the municipality of Xapuri, state of Acre, northern Brazil. It distinguish-es from other species by the presence of an immaculate ventral coloration, SVL larger than 31 mm, and width head morethan 6.9 mm in adult males. Multivariate analysis based on external morphology also distinguishes the new species from the most morphologically similar species. The advertisement call is described and tadpoles remain unknown.

A new species of Bulbostylis (Cyperaceae), only known from the Brazilian Amazonian coast, is here described and illustrated. Bulbostylis litoreamazonicola was found growing over dunes, in seasonally flooded restinga vegetation, and in humid fields near the mangroves from the State of Pará, Northern Brazil. This is the fifth Brazilian-native species of Bulbostylis lacking a persistent stylopodium on the mature fruit. The new species is mainly characterized by its annual habit, simple anthelate inflorescences, densely hispid to hispidulous longitudinally ribbed scapes, pubescent glumes, and cordiform nutlets.

We describe a new species of glassfrog from the cloud forest of Manu National Park, southern Peru, at elevations of 2750–2800m. The new species is similar in morphology to Centrolene lemniscatum, which occurs in northern Peru at elevations of2000–2280 m. Both species have white labial stripes, humeral spines, and lack vomerine teeth. The new species differs from C.lemniscatum by its larger size, labial stripe extending into a distinct lateral stripe instead of a discontinuous lateral stripe, snoutprofile inclined anteroventrally instead of bluntly rounded, greater depression in the internarial area, and by having stronglyprotruding nostrils. Males of the new species emit long calls with 8–14 peaked notes, instead of a short tonal note in C. lemnis-catum. Another morphologically similar species, C. buckleyi, has a short advertisement call composed of 1–5 notes, and isgenetically distinct from the new species. This new Centrolene extends the known distribution of Centrolene to the south by 600 km, and is the southernmost species of this genus.

Adults and tadpoles of a new species of the genus Leptodactylus are described from southeastern Brazil. Leptodactylus thomei sp.nov. can be found amidst the leaf litter within cocoa plantations along the northern coastal region of the state of Espírito Santo. It can be distinguished from other species of the Leptodactylus marmoratus group by its advertisement call, which is described, together with agonistic calls, and compared to advertisement calls of other species of the group that occur in southern and southeastern Brazil. The systematics of associated populations is discussed.

We describe a new species of Phyllodytes from Ilhéus (15º04’S, 39º03’W; 95 m above sea level), south of state of Bahia, in the northeastern Atlantic Forest of Brazil. Phyllodytes megatympanum sp. nov. is diagnosable by the following combination of characters: (1) dorsum of body, arms, and legs uniformly light brown; (2) groin yellow; (3) snout pointed in dorsal view, protruding in profile; (4) tympanum large with a round distinct tympanic annulus; (5) adult males with two anterior large odontoids followed by a series of smaller odontoids on each side of the mandible; (6) well-developed tubercle near tibio-tarsal joint; (7) advertisement call composed of a series of 12 to 19 unpulsed notes, with harmonic structure and (8) mean dominant frequency of 3.98 kHz.

Nurse frogs (Aromobatidae: Allobates) are probably the most extensively studied genus by taxonomists in Brazilian Amazonia. The southwestern portion of Amazonia is the most species-rich: as many as seven species may occur in sympatry at a single locality. In this study, we describe a new species of nurse frog from this region. The description integrates data from larval and adult morphology, advertisement calls and DNA sequences. Allobates velocicantus sp. nov. is distinguished from other Allobates mainly by the absence of hourglass-shaped dark marks on the dorsum and dark transverse bars on the thigh; a throat that is white centrally and yellow marginally; basal webbing on toes II and III; finger I longer than finger II; and an advertisement call composed of 66–138 pulsed notes with a note duration of 5–13 ms, inter-note intervals of 10–18 ms and a dominant frequency of 5,512–6,158 Hz. Tadpoles of the new species have 3–4 short, rounded papillae on the anterior labium, 16–23 papillae on the posterior labium, and a labial keratodont row formula 2(2)/3(1). This is the fifth species of Allobates described from the state of Acre, southwestern Brazilian Amazonia.

A new species, Justicia carajensis, is described from the Serra dos Carajás as part of the ongoing taxonomic study of Justicia from the state of Pará in northern Brazil. Morphologically, it belongs to Justicia sect. Chaetothylax, and differs from other species by a combination of characters of calyx lobe length and indumentum, corolla tube shape, anther morphology, and ovary and fruit indumentum.

A new species of Pseudopaludicola is described from the state of Mato Grosso, western Brazil. The new species inhabitsthe transition zone between Brazilian Cerrado and Amazon rainforest in northern Mato Grosso, and is characterized by itsmedium size (snout-vent length 12–17 mm), lack of T-shaped terminal phalanges, toe tips not expanded laterally, presenceof two antebrachial tubercles, and smooth upper eyelids. The advertisement call of the new species consists of a seriescomposed of 11–74 non-pulsed notes. Mean dominant frequency is 3938 Hz. Each note presents a slight ascendantfrequency modulation in its first half, and another ascendant modulation in its last half. We also present new data on the distribution and conservation status of Pseudopaludicola canga.
